AHH HA i found the website http://www.allpar.com/cars/lx/magnum-dodge.html

0-60 = 9.1
0-100 = 25
1/4 mile = 16.94@84.38

after seeing all that, i have to say that the HEMI is a must

What do you want for a car with a blunt nose that weighs very close to 2 tons and has 250 HP / 250 FtLbs powering it? Not dissing the car, they're kind of cool looking, but the facts still dictate that unless it has a hemi under the hood the motivation is not going to be that great. Some people don't want to do high 13's or low 14's in their cars, they just want to cruise instead.
